Make a Spending Plan and Start Conserving

Shipping, gas, hotel and insurance expenses stack up quickly. Add down payment for leasing and starting utilities in your new house, and it ends up being clear that moving requires numerous in advance expenditures that can drain your bank account. Making a cost savings and a budget plan to cover the expenses will assist smooth the shift, but don't depend on the down payment from your old location to cover those costs. It often takes weeks and in some cases longer for a proprietor to reimburse your security deposit (inspect your lease to be sure).

Your budget plan preparation should not stop when you get to your destination. Expense of living differs from area to region, and your current income may not manage you the very same high-ends after the move. Use a cost of living calculator to identify how far your present wage will take you in particular cities throughout the country to see if moving out of state is a smart fiscal concept.
Inspect What Your Company Will Cover

Some business cover relocation costs, but it is essential to know precisely what that requires. Your company might reimburse items such as shipping services, packing services, transportation and travel costs connected with browsing for your brand-new house-- if you are moving specifically for the job. Negotiate during the employing process and ask whether your company will cover other expenses such as lease cancellation costs, real estate agent help, temporary housing and storage.

Prepare For Partial-Year State Taxes

While you are subtracting expenditures on your federal tax return at tax time, remember that you might need to submit 2 different state tax returns when you move out of state. If you earned income in two different states during the -- unless you are transferring to or from a state that does not collect individual income taxes, such as Texas, Nevada or Washington-- you will need to file a return in each state to cover the time you lived there.
Research Movers, Truck Rentals and Shipping Companies

The three most popular methods to carry personal belongings throughout state lines are via professional movers, more info truck rental business such as U-Haul, and container services such as PODS, which supply self-storage containers that you fill and the business transportations. Each service has its own benefits, costs can vary significantly:

Professional Movers:
If you go with complete, the movers will pack, load, ship, and unload all of your personal belongings, so the only thing left for you to do is to inform them where to park the sofa. Many individuals select to do the packaging themselves to save cash and guarantee proper handling.

Estimating the costs of professional moving services isn't as simple as leaping online. Movers such as United Van Lines send out a specialist to your house to evaluate your products and supply a quote. Unlike moving trucks and shipping services, movers typically do not aspect in mileage as much as weight of freight. Expert movers can get expensive, but their services will allow you to focus on other pushing concerns surrounding a relocation.
Truck Rental Companies:
Moving truck rental is not for everyone. You need to be comfy driving a big automobile without a rearview mirror (using side mirrors instead), and you need to be familiar with the included length and width of the automobile when maneuvering and changing lanes through narrow streets. The majority of truck rental business do not provide any training on how to drive a large truck, so first-timers may need time to change. Normally the only requirements for leasing a moving truck are that the chauffeur be 25 years of age or older and have a valid driver's license.

Truck rental business normally base their rates on the size of the truck (measured in length from 10-foot to 26-foot trucks), distance of travel, days of usage and insurance coverage. Make sure to assess the size of your truck against your personal belongings so you do not pay for unnecessary space.
Shipping Container Companies:
Delivering services such as PODS and Door To Door take the trouble out of transferring your items. The business provides a storage container to your present home and you define where you desire the company to put the container (e.g., in the driveway or in a designated spot on the street). You load the container nevertheless you like, securing it with your own padlock.

On a designated move date, the business returns to pick up your container and ship it to your location, where you'll unload at your leisure. The shipping business often will hold the container at a storage center if you do not know where you will be living in your new city yet. You can save your products for a monthly rate (comparable to self-storage lockers), nevertheless you can not access your possessions while they are in storage.

These containers take up space and you are not able to move them on your own. Preferably you ought to have a driveway or private parking area (both in your departure city and your destination) to accommodate the container for at least a couple days while you unload and fill.

Keep Your Valuables Close

That heirloom Rolex, your granny's pearls and that 1952 Mickey Mantle novice baseball card are the types of products you ought to not send loading with the replaceable dishware. Keep irreplaceable products with you at all times, whether you are driving or flying.
